+#include "../InferenceTest.hpp"
+#include "../MobileNetDatabase.hpp"
+#include "armnnTfParser/ITfParser.hpp"
+
+int main(int argc, char* argv[])
+{
+ std::vector<ImageSet> imageSet =
+ {
+ {"Dog.jpg", 209},
+ // top five predictions in tensorflow:
+ // -----------------------------------
+ // 209:Labrador retriever 0.949995
+ // 160:Rhodesian ridgeback 0.0270182
+ // 208:golden retriever 0.0192866
+ // 853:tennis ball 0.000470382
+ // 239:Greater Swiss Mountain dog 0.000464451
+ {"Cat.jpg", 283},
+ // top five predictions in tensorflow:
+ // -----------------------------------
+ // 283:tiger cat 0.579016
+ // 286:Egyptian cat 0.319676
+ // 282:tabby, tabby cat 0.0873346
+ // 288:lynx, catamount 0.011163
+ // 289:leopard, Panthera pardus 0.000856755
+ {"shark.jpg", 3},
+ // top five predictions in tensorflow:
+ // -----------------------------------
+ // 3:great white shark, white shark, ... 0.996926
+ // 4:tiger shark, Galeocerdo cuvieri 0.00270528
+ // 149:killer whale, killer, orca, ... 0.000121848
+ // 395:sturgeon 7.78977e-05
+ // 5:hammerhead, hammerhead shark 6.44127e-055
+ };
+
+ armnn::TensorShape inputTensorShape({ 1, 224, 224, 3 });
+ return armnn::test::ClassifierInferenceTestMain<MobileNetDatabase, armnnTfParser::ITfParser>(
+ argc, argv, "mobilenet_v1_1.0_224_fp32.pb", true, "input", "output", { 0, 1, 2 },
+ [&imageSet](const char* dataDir) {
+ return MobileNetDatabase(
+ dataDir,
+ 224,
+ 224,
+ imageSet);
+ },
+ &inputTensorShape);
+}
